Numeral
- The cardinal number immediately following seventy-three and preceding seventy-five.
- Arabic numerals: 74
- Roman numerals: LXXIV, LXXIIII
- French: soixante-quatorze
- German: vierundsiebzig
- Italian: settantaquattro
- Portuguese: setenta e quatro
- Russian: се́мьдесят четы́ре
- Spanish: setenta y cuatro
seventy-four (plural seventy-fours)
- (historical) A ship having seventy-four guns.
- 1820, Lord Byron, Don Juan, V:
- the ocean stream / Here and there studded with a seventy-four [...].
